Christ Church is built in the Victorian Gothic Revival style of locally quarried limstone walls and a shingle roof. The foundation stone was laid on 10 September 1892 and consecrated on 11th April 1893., making it one of the oldest suburban parish churches in Perth. Extensions to the church were built in 1901 and 1909, the tower was completed in 1938 with the bells from the church of St Paul's, Canonbury, London being installed in 1988
